The thyroid gland is a vital endocrine (hormone-producing) gland that plays a significant duty in chemical responses in the body (our metabolic process). It is located at the front of the neck, listed below the voice box, and is butterfly-shaped. The thyroid gland produces the thyroid hormonal agents triiodothyronine (T3) and thyroxine (T4), among various other things.


The production of the thyroid hormonal agents is controlled by the pituitary gland (hypophysis). The pituitary gland makes a hormonal agent called TSH (thyroid-stimulating hormone). TSH not just boosts the production of thyroid hormonal agents it also affects the dimension of the thyroid gland. A blood test can be done to establish the quantities of hormones made by the thyroid gland. Blood examinations can measure the degrees of TSH and the thyroid hormones triiodothyronine (T3) and thyroxine (T4).


For this reason, it is typical to only determine the TSH degree at. If the TSH level in the blood is greater or less than regular, the degrees of the thyroid hormones T3 and T4 are additionally measured. The majority of thyroid hormones are bound to particular proteins in the blood.


An additional hormone created by the thyroid gland is called calcitonin. The degree of calcitonin in the blood is typically just measured if there is factor to think that someone has a specific kind of thyroid cancer that boosts the quantity of calcitonin.
